Abstract

A roller of the input device comprises a base plate, a bearing component equipped with at least a support bracket on the base plate wherein a swinging bracket is supported on the support bracket, a circuit base plate positioned between the base plate and the bearing component and equipped with a horizontal contact switch on both sides of the swinging bracket, a roller set positioned on the swinging bracket and positioned with a coder on one internal side. Through the structure above, the operator can swing the swinging bracket left and right by pushing the roller set to touch the horizontal contact switch on both sides of the swinging bracket. The direction of pushing by the operator's hand is adaptable to the touching direction of the swinging bracket to the horizontal contact switch, which thereby makes the hand perceive good touch in operation and ensures accuracy of controlling the side point.

Yet the present roller structure of the input media developed of industrial community, the lateral press operating key that it adopted are in roller body and the support member both sides that are used for the support roller body and are provided with vertical switch, and are provided with horizontal cross bar in support member both sides.
As above structure when user's sideshake roller body, can drive the horizontal cross bar skew according to lever principle and press down the vertical switch that clicks the control correspondence, and to the host computer output order.
During the actual use of right as above-mentioned structure, because the surface of contact of vertical switch up, by use habit, when user's side pressure roller body, tend to follow the power that presses down, and press down and side pressure owing to differentiating during operation, and user's hand emotivity is poor, can't guarantee the accuracy of lateral points selected control system, drive easily that horizontal cross bar presses down and simultaneously the vertical switch of both sides or side direction press by uncertain, cause input media to host computer output error instruction or leakage instruction, cause puzzlement very big in the use.

As above-mentioned structure, according to Fig. 1, Fig. 4, Fig. 5, Fig. 6, Fig. 7 and shown in Figure 8, this waves 1 of bearing 22 and this base plate, overlap the locating convex block 12 that is fixed in this body of rod that waves bearing 22 222 and this base plate 1 respectively by these flexible member 13 two ends, make this wave bearing 22 and obtain resiliency supported, when this waved bearing 22 stressed swings or presses downwards, when the compressing power disappears, restoring force that can be by this flexible member 13 is the involution location again.When operating, the user can click this roller set 4 via the hand vertical depression, band presses down the bearing 22 that waves of this support member 2 synchronously, make this clamping block 22 4 that waves bearing 22 bottoms compress on this circuit substrate 3 corresponding this vertical touch-pressure switch 33 downwards, make this vertical touch-pressure switch 33 send signal and instruct host computer output is corresponding.
The user also can be via the hand horizontal side to promoting this roller set 4, and band makes waving that bearing 22 swing to the left or swinging to the right of this support member 2 synchronously.
When user's hand promotes this roller set 4 to the left, being with synchronously and making this minor axis 221 that waves bearing 22 front and back ends of this support member 2 is the strong point with this two bracing frame 21, making this wave bearing 22 swings to the right, band makes this wave this set pendulum hypophysis 223 of bearing 22 front ends swing to the right thereupon, and in swing process, these pendulum hypophysis 223 right-hand ends just touch corresponding this horizontal touch-pressure switch 34 in these circuit substrate 3 right sides, make this horizontal touch-pressure switch 34 send signal and to the corresponding instruction of host computer output.
When user's hand promotes this roller set 4 to the right, being with synchronously and making this minor axis 221 that waves bearing 22 front and back ends of this support member 2 is the strong point with this two bracing frame 21, making this wave bearing 22 swings to the left, band makes this wave this set pendulum hypophysis 223 of bearing 22 front ends swing to the left thereupon, and in swing process, these pendulum hypophysis 223 left-hand end are just touched corresponding this horizontal touch-pressure switch 34 of these circuit substrate 3 upper left sides, make this horizontal touch-pressure switch 34 send signal and to the corresponding instruction of host computer output.
Because these roller set 4 relative side direction operating keys are to adopt horizontal touch-pressure switch 34 on this circuit substrate 3, with vertical to vertical touch-pressure switch that operating key adopted 33 its to touch directions different, therefore when pressing down this roller set 4, user's hand clicks, when making this clamping block 224 that waves bearing 22 bottoms compress on this circuit substrate 3 the vertical touch-pressure switch 33 of corresponding this downwards, this waves this set pendulum hypophysis 223 of bearing 22 front ends and also presses down thereupon, because this pendulum hypophysis 223 is swung, so will can not trigger a left side on this circuit substrate 3 in the operating process, this horizontal touch-pressure switch 34 of right both sides, former removing from when descending press operation is because of a left side on this circuit substrate 3 of false touch, this horizontal touch-pressure switch 34 of right both sides and situation that the host computer output error is instructed.
It is same when user's hand carries out the side direction promotion and clicks this roller set 4, make this wave this set pendulum hypophysis 223 of bearing 22 bottom front ends and carry out sideshake to opposite side thereupon, further on this circuit substrate 3 of pushing and pressing during the horizontal touch-pressure switch 34 of corresponding this, this clamping block 224 that waves bearing 22 bottoms also carries out sideshake thereupon, because this clamping block 224 does not press down, so will can not trigger this corresponding on this circuit substrate 3 vertical touch-pressure switch 33 in the operating process, former removing from when descending press operation is because of the situation of this vertical touch-pressure switch 33 on this circuit substrate 3 of false touch to host computer output error instruction.
